Revealing the Secrets of Modern White Countertops

Choosing between marble and quartz for your white countertop bars can drastically influence the aesthetic and functionality of your space. Both materials bring distinct advantages, and understanding these can guide you to the perfect choice for your elegant home bar ideas.

offers timeless beauty with its natural veining and luxurious appeal. It's perfect for those who cherish a classic and sophisticated look. However, marble is porous and can stain or scratch if not sealed and maintained properly. If your seated home bar design incorporates heavy use, frequent maintenance might be essential to retain its pristine condition.

On the other hand, provides a more durable and low-maintenance alternative. As an engineered stone, quartz offers uniform color and pattern, which can lend a sleek and modern touch to your transformative bar setups. Unlike marble, it resists stains and scratches, making it ideal for DIY home bars, where ease of upkeep is crucial.

Ultimately, your choice will depend on your priorities in terms of aesthetics, maintenance, and use frequency. Assessing these aspects will help you decide the right white for your chic basement bars.

Maximizing both comfort and style in your bar layout is essential for creating an inviting space. Start by positioning seated areas so that guests face each other, promoting interaction and engagement. Incorporate multi-level seating to accommodate different tastes and heights—think stools with adjustable height settings that complement your bar’s elegant home bar ideas.

Incorporating mirrors on walls can expand the perceived space, making even compact areas feel more significant. Plan your layout around accessibility, ensuring that seating arrangements don't obstruct pathways or the bartender’s workspace. Combining versatile furniture and modular designs provides flexibility without sacrificing elegance or comfort.

Creating a seated home bar with white countertops is just the beginning; to truly transform your space, you need to carefully select the right accessories. These extras are not just decorative—they're functional necessities that elevate your bar's style and usability.

Ensure you have a comprehensive set of bar tools. Key items include a shaker, strainer, muddler, jigger, and bar spoon. These are critical for crafting cocktails and impressing guests with your bartending prowess.
